发布时间: 2023-04-11 20:30:01 浏览次数:
作为新手开发人员或者网站管理员,您一定听到过绝对路径这个词。那么,什么是绝对路径?它是如何与网站开发相关呢?通过本文,您将全方位了解什么是绝对路径以及如何使用它来改进您的网站开发和管理。
在互联网世界中,绝对路径是指从主机根目录开始的完整路径。互联网中的任何URL都包括协议、域名和文件路径等信息,绝对路径是其中的一部分。例如,https://www.example.com/path/to/file是一个URL,其中/path/to/file就是绝对路径部分,它从主机根目录开始,指向文件的确切位置。
绝对路径具有以下几个重要的优点:
应该在下列情况下使用绝对路径:
相对路径和绝对路径之间的主要区别在于它们从哪里开始计算路径。相对路径从当前文件夹开始,而绝对路径从主机根目录开始。
相对路径的示例:
./images/picture.jpg
绝对路径的示例:
https://www.example.com/images/picture.jpg
在编写代码或管理网站时,使用绝对路径可以大大提高效率。在这里,我们将介绍如何使用不同的编程语言和服务器来使用绝对路径。
在HTML中,img标签通常用于插入图片。使用绝对路径,如下所示:
html
<img src="https://www.example.com/images/picture.jpg" />
在PHP中,可以使用dirname()和其他专用函数以绝对路径方式引用各种资源。以下是一个例子:
php
<img src="<?php echo dirname(__FILE__); ?>/images/picture.jpg" />
在Node.js中,使用__dirname变量可以指向当前文件夹。以下是一个使用绝对路径的例子:
javascript
var path = require('path');
var imagePath = path.join(__dirname, 'images', 'picture.jpg');
在Nginx中,只需在配置文件中设置root指令即可使用绝对路径。以下是一个例子:
server {
listen 80;
server_name example.com;
root /var/www/example.com;
location / {
...
}
}
A:相对路径和绝对路径之间的区别在于它们计算路径的开始位置不同。相对路径从当前文件夹开始,而绝对路径从主机根目录开始。
A:应该在网站结构很复杂,需要一个确定的路径来指向文件时或需要在不同的页面之间共享资源时等情况下使用绝对路径。
绝对路径是互联网世界中非常重要的概念。选择正确的路径链接方式对于网站管理员和开发人员而言是至关重要的。与相对路径相比,使用绝对路径有许多优点。在不同的编程语言和服务器中,使用绝对路径都非常简单。希望本文能够帮助您更好地理解什么是绝对路径及其在网站开发中的应用。
上一篇: 微信是什么公司开发的:一款全球人民所共享的通讯软件
下一篇:微信公众号客服系统- 新趋势